£39,200 to Holbeach Hospital to maintain help in community

Holbeach Hospital has been gifted £39,200 by Holbeach Nursing Association to enable it to continue to help the local community.
 
Holbeach Nursing Association (originally Holbeach Sick Poor Fund) was set up before the Health Service was established in order to provide help to the local community to cover the extras required when illness happened in a family. Over the years, the charity has provided equipment and financial help in order to provide comfort to the sick.

As trustees of the association it was decided to donate the funds held to Holbeach and East Elloe Hospital Trust in order that the work can be continued within the local area.

Holbeach Hospital manager Maxine Winch said she was extremely grateful for the generous donation and already has plans to put the money to good use.

She said: “Although the nursing association will no longer exist, the money they have raised over the years will still benefit the local community.
“The members should be very proud of the substantial amount donated to us; it will be used to help fund our expansion projects which seems a fitting legacy.

“On behalf of the trustees and those who use our service I would like to extend thanks for this extremely generous gift.”
